Job Summary
In this role, you will develop cybersecurity concepts, conduct risk analyses and security assessments, and coordinate security measures throughout the entire project lifecycle of metro projects.
Your role in the team
- They ensure compliance with all cybersecurity standards, regulatory requirements, and CRA obligations in metro/rolling stock projects.
- They develop cybersecurity concepts and measures and implement them throughout the entire project lifecycle.
- They conduct Threat Analyses (TRA) and Security Risk Assessments and derive concrete security measures from them.
- You coordinate all security-related topics with internal and external stakeholders, including the client, suppliers, and consortium partners.
- They create security documentation and monitor project-related security KPIs.
- You develop incident response processes further, manage process governance, and drive continuous improvements (KVP) within the project and the organization.

Our expectations of you
Education
- You hold a degree in Computer Science, IT Security, Information Technology, or a comparable technical field.
Qualifications
- You possess in-depth knowledge of relevant standards such as IEC 62443, ISO 27001, and EN 50701, and are familiar with regulatory requirements such as CRA and NIS2.
- You conduct security assessments confidently, utilize TRA methods effectively, and ideally have knowledge in penetration testing.
- You understand industrial control and vehicle networks and comply with the relevant safety requirements.
- You communicate clearly, confidently manage stakeholders, and work in a structured, self-responsible, and solution-oriented manner.
- You have fluent spoken and written skills in German and English.
Experience
- You bring several years of experience in cybersecurity within an industrial or safety-critical environment, ideally in the railway sector.
